Agnostic Front’s ‘Live at CBGB’ Reissue Due in July: Band to Perform Album in Entirety at 30th Anniversary Shows

by | May 12, 2012

Agnostic Front’s 1989 Live at CBGB release will be reissued on July 17th through Bridge Nine.

The effort is in support of the band’s upcoming string of 30th anniversary shows in which they will perform the release in its entirety. Dates and the track list are below.
